Burkitt’s lymphoma (BL), a variety of non-Hodgkin’s lymphoma, though uncommon in India. Cardiac involvement in sporadic Burkitt’s lymphoma is even more a rare occurence. In such cases, cardiac involvement may be primary or a part of a systemic disease process. It is known to affect the endocardium, myocardium, or pericardium. Cardiac symptoms may or may not be present in the early clinical stages.
A recent case report published in the Journal of Associations of Physicians of India elaborates on a unique case study of a 13-year-old boy diagnosed with Burkitt’s Lymphoma with an Unusual Cardiac Involvement

It has been just over 50 years since the description of Burkitt Lymphoma (BL) as an unusual tumor affecting jaws of African children. Seminal discoveries linked to BL includ Epstein-Barr virus, the first human virus linked to a human cancer, the linkage of BL to Plasmodium falciparum malaria, chromosomal translocations involving c-myc and immunoglobulin promoter elements, and demonstration of rapid and curative response to chemotherapy. Dubbed the Rosetta stone of cancer, BL became a complex model for carcinogenesis involving poly-microbes, immunity and host-genetics.
Fifty years later, many fundamental questions remain unanswered. Why BL occurs in a small fraction of people chronically exposed to malaria and/or EBV, the risk conveyed by infections singly or jointly, the specific malaria or EBV proteins involved, and whether EBV or malaria have high-risk variants for BL and the pathogen-host interactions involved in BL. Burkitt's lymphoma is an aggressive form of lymphoma that affects the B- lymphocytes.
It accounts for approximately 0.3-1.3% of all non-Hodgkin lymphomas.
